One of the most common methods for measuring core body temperature is through the use of thermometers. Traditional thermometers, such as oral, rectal, and axillary thermometers, have been widely used for decades to monitor body temperature. However, these methods are invasive and can be uncomfortable for the individual being tested. Additionally, they may not always provide accurate results, especially in critical situations where real-time monitoring is necessary.
Advancements in technology have led to the development of more sophisticated core body temperature measurement devices that offer non-invasive and precise temperature readings. These devices utilize innovative sensors and wireless connectivity to continuously monitor body temperature, providing real-time data that can be accessed remotely by healthcare providers or coaches.
One such device is the wearable temperature sensor, which can be attached to the skin to monitor core body temperature continuously. These sensors are equipped with smart technology that can track temperature fluctuations and send alerts if a person’s temperature exceeds a predefined threshold. This feature is particularly useful in healthcare settings, where early detection of fever or hyperthermia can prevent serious medical complications.
In the sports industry, core body temperature measurement devices play a vital role in monitoring athletes during training and competitions. By tracking body temperature in real-time, coaches and sports scientists can optimize performance and minimize the risk of heat-related illnesses. Athletes can wear these devices during workouts to ensure they are staying within their safe temperature range, helping them train more effectively and prevent overheating.
Occupational safety is another area where core body temperature measurement devices are instrumental. Workers in industries such as construction, firefighting, and manufacturing are often exposed to extreme temperatures, which can pose serious health risks. By using temperature monitoring devices, employers can ensure the well-being of their employees by implementing measures to prevent heat stress and other heat-related illnesses.
In medical settings, core body temperature measurement devices are used to monitor patients with conditions that require careful temperature regulation, such as sepsis, hypothermia, or hyperthermia. These devices can detect even subtle changes in body temperature, allowing healthcare providers to intervene promptly and deliver appropriate treatment.
